This 1989 Lloyd Clifton-designed course is very hilly. It offers a breathtaking view of Lake Griffin. The layout itself is fairly simple: only three holes have water, and they are all on the back nine. The Back tees are a little long for the average player, but with so little water, they are worth a try if you feel strong. This is a semi-private golf course. Soft spikes only.
